Join our team as an Application Support Analyst and become the critical link between technology and operations. In this role, you’ll analyze workflows, optimize business processes, and ensure seamless integration of software applications that drive clinical and operational excellence. If you enjoy problem-solving, collaborating with diverse teams, and leveraging technology to improve outcomes, this position offers an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ful impact.

Essential Functions

  • Identify, map, and analyze clinical and business processes to improve workflows and system utilization.
  • Develop and execute test plans, cases, and scripts for unit, integration, and user acceptance testing.
  • Collaborate with IT to translate user requirements into functional design specifications and ensure accurate implementation.
  • Maintain process documentation, including workflows, functional specifications, installation instructions, and troubleshooting guidelines.
  • Review data integrity, audit reports, and recommend system improvements or product development opportunities.
  • Provide end-user training and education on application functionality; evaluate and update training materials as needed.
  • Consult with providers, leadership, and clinicians to resolve application-related issues and optimize functionality.
  • Support project timelines and ensure successful completion of application-related initiatives.

Education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Management, Computer Science, or related field (required).
  • Additional certifications may be required based on specialty (e.g., RHIA, RHIT, CPC for HIM/HB or PB Support Analysts).

Skills & Qualifications

  • Minimum of 3 years’ experience in business process mapping, workflow analysis, and application support.
  • Experience with clinical systems, user training, and vendor engagement.
  • Strong analytical skills for data-driven decision-making and process improvement.
  • Project management experience and familiarity with project management tools.
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ills; ability to manage multiple priorities.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and large-scale automated systems.
  • Understanding of change management practices and procedures.

About Advocate Health

Advocate Health is the third-largest nonprofit, integrated health system in the United States, created from the combination of Advocate Aurora Health and Atrium Health. Providing care under the names Advocate Health Care in Illinois; Atrium Health in the Carolinas, Georgia and Alabama; and Aurora Health Care in Wisconsin, Advocate Health is a national leader in clinical innovation, health outcomes, consumer experience and value-based care.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Advocate Health services nearly 6 million patients and is engaged in hundreds of clinical trials and research studies, with Wake Forest University School of Medicine serving as the academic core of the enterprise. It is nationally recognized for its expertise in cardiology, neurosciences, oncology, pediatrics and rehabilitation, as well as organ transplants, burn treatments and specialized musculoskeletal programs. Advocate Health employs 155,000 teammates across 69 hospitals and over 1,000 care locations, and offers one of the nation’s largest graduate medical education programs with over 2,000 residents and fellows across more than 200 programs. Committed to providing equitable care for all, Advocate Health provides more than $6 billion in annual community benefits.
